Giulia Sita is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Physiology and Oncology. According to data from OpenAlex, Giulia Sita has authored 35 papers receiving a total of 1.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Molecular Biology, 9 papers in Physiology and 5 papers in Oncology. Recurrent topics in Giulia Sita’s work include Genomics, phytochemicals, and oxidative stress (10 papers), Alzheimer's disease research and treatments (7 papers) and Estrogen and related hormone effects (5 papers). Giulia Sita is often cited by papers focused on Genomics, phytochemicals, and oxidative stress (10 papers), Alzheimer's disease research and treatments (7 papers) and Estrogen and related hormone effects (5 papers). Giulia Sita collaborates with scholars based in Italy, Brazil and Finland. Giulia Sita's co-authors include Fabiana Morroni, Patrizia Hrelia, Andrea Tarozzi, Josef Anrather, David Brea, Gianfranco Racchumi, Costantino Iadecola, Jamie Moore, Michelle Murphy and Corinne Benakis and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Nature Medicine and Stroke.
